WASHINGTON, D.C., May 9, 2024— On Wednesday, Fannie Mae and Freddie Mac announced the postponement of a June 1 implementation of updates to their selling and servicing guides to clarify various lender and servicer responsibilities related to monitoring and verifying property insurance coverage.
ALEXANDRIA, VA (April 24, 2024) –Flooding is the most common natural disaster and can cause severe damage to homes and businesses. However, a recent survey revealed that only 14% of Americans have flood insurance, so why aren’t more consumers considering coverage? The answer is two-fold: first, many consumers mistakenly believe that their homeowners or renters insurance policies already cover flood-related damage; in addition, many consumers think that a flood will not impact their property because they are far from bodies of water.
